视觉测量,作为一种非接触式的测量方法,在工业检测、三维重建、自动驾驶等领域发挥着越来越重要的作用。逆向视觉测量作为一种特殊的视觉测量方法,能够将真实世界中的物体转换为计算机可以处理的数字模型,从而实现精确的捕捉和分析。本文将详细介绍逆向视觉测量的原理、技术以及应用。
原理概述
逆向视觉测量,顾名思义,是将现实世界中的物体通过视觉系统进行捕捉,然后将其转换为数字模型的过程。这一过程主要包括以下几个步骤:
- 图像采集:利用摄像头等视觉传感器,采集物体表面的图像。
- 图像处理:对采集到的图像进行预处理,如去噪、增强等。
- 特征提取:从预处理后的图像中提取关键特征,如角点、边缘等。
- 三维重建:利用提取到的特征,通过数学模型计算物体表面的三维坐标。
- 模型优化:对重建出的三维模型进行优化,提高其精度和完整性。
技术方法
1. 基于几何的特征匹配
基于几何的特征匹配是逆向视觉测量中最常用的技术之一。其核心思想是:通过比较两个图像中对应特征点的几何关系,来估计物体表面的三维坐标。常用的几何特征匹配方法包括:
- 点特征匹配:如SIFT(尺度不变特征变换)、SURF(加速稳健特征)等。
- 线特征匹配:如Hough变换、P-Ransac(概率性RANSAC)等。
2. 基于图像的深度估计
基于图像的深度估计方法通过分析图像中的像素信息,直接估计物体表面的深度信息。这类方法主要包括:
- 单视图深度估计:如DeepSFM、DGC-Net等。
- 多视图深度估计:如Multi-View Stereo(MVS)、DeepMVS等。
3. 基于深度学习的三维重建
随着深度学习技术的快速发展,基于深度学习的三维重建方法在逆向视觉测量领域取得了显著的成果。这类方法主要包括:
- 卷积神经网络(CNN):如PointNet、PointNet++等。
- 生成对抗网络(GAN):如DeepVoxels、Pix2Vox等。
应用领域
逆向视觉测量在各个领域都有广泛的应用,以下列举几个典型的应用场景:
1. 工业检测
在工业生产过程中,逆向视觉测量可用于检测产品尺寸、形状、缺陷等信息,提高产品质量和自动化程度。例如,在汽车制造业中,逆向视觉测量可用于检测汽车零部件的尺寸、形状等。
2. 三维重建
逆向视觉测量可用于将现实世界中的物体转换为三维模型,为虚拟现实、增强现实等领域提供数据支持。例如,在文化遗产保护领域,逆向视觉测量可用于重建古代建筑、文物等。
3. 自动驾驶
在自动驾驶领域,逆向视觉测量可用于感知周围环境,为车辆提供导航和避障等信息。例如,在车辆自动驾驶过程中,逆向视觉测量可用于识别道路标志、行人和车辆等。
总结
逆向视觉测量作为一种新兴的视觉测量方法,在各个领域都有广泛的应用前景。随着技术的不断发展和完善,逆向视觉测量将在更多领域发挥重要作用。
